Learning Outcomes (ELOs)

A. Attitude

A.1. Graduates are able to demonstrate attitudes as individuals who uphold religious, humanist, moral, and ethical values in the field of Mathematics Education.
A.2.Graduates are able to demonstrate the attitude of discipline, independence, responsibility, teamwork, respect for differences, nationalism; and contribute to the advancement of civilization based on Pancasila through Mathematics Education.

B. General Skills

B.1.Graduates are able to apply logical, critical, systematic and creative thinking in the context of science and technology development which are relevant to mathematics education.
B.2.Graduates are able to demonstrate academic writing in the form of scientific reports in the field of mathematics education.
B.3.Graduates are able to apply information and data literacy to solve problems in Mathematics Education.

C. Knowledge

C.1.Graduates are able to explain pedagogical-didactic concepts of mathematics in order to plan, do, evaluate the teaching and learning of mathematics in secondary education or to continue their study at graduate level by taking the life skills and Islamic values.
C.2.Graduates are able to explain the theoretical concepts of mathematics for school level or for their continuing study at graduate level that support the mathematics education in both levels.
C.3.Graduates are able to explain factual, conceptual and procedural knowledge about the use of information and communication technology for the teaching and learning of mathematics at secondary school level.

D. Specific Skills

D.1.Graduates are able to modify learning tools, implement, and evaluate the application of mathematics learning tools in an innovative way and in accordance with Islamic values by applying mathematical and scientific pedagogic-didactic concepts, and utilizing various learning resources and science and technology that are oriented towards life skills.
D.2.Graduates are able to conduct research in the field of mathematics education.
D.3.Graduates are able to establish entrepreneurial activities that support creativity and innovation in the field of mathematics.
